Want to have mail coming into or going out of exchange mailbox automatically
go to inbox, sent items, etc. in a pst folder. The pst would mirror the
standard mailbox folder. Was able to do this in outlook 2000 , but can't
figure it in 2003. Any suggestions?

You can use rules to do a lot of things. That said, I don't know why you'd
want to use a PST when you have such a better option with Exchange -
See
http://www.exchangefaq.org/faq/Exchange-5.5/Why-PST-=-BAD-/q/Why-PST-=-BAD/qid/1209

And since you have Exchange, why not use cached mode w/OL2003 so you have an
*OST* file that is an automatic mirror of the mailbox?

set the pst as the default delivery location in tools, accounts, view or
change email accounts.
